Loose or Shifting Pearly Whites
If you observe your teeth becoming loosened or shifting, it's critical to consult a dental surgeon promptly. This could be an indication of a significant oral problem that requires punctual interest. Here are some reasons that loosened or moving teeth should not be ignored:
- Trauma or injury: Teeth can come to be loosened as a result of an impact to the mouth or face. A dental specialist can evaluate the damages and offer ideal therapy.
- Gum disease: Advanced gum tissue illness can cause the sustaining frameworks of the teeth to damage, leading to tooth movement. A dental surgeon can assess the degree of the condition and recommend therapy options.
- Tooth decay: Extreme decay can weaken the honesty of the tooth, creating it to end up being loose. An oral specialist can establish the very best strategy.
- Bite problems: Misaligned teeth or an improper bite can create teeth to shift or come to be loosened. An oral specialist can deal with these problems and avoid further damage.
- Bone loss: In many cases, bone loss in the jaw can cause teeth to end up being loose. An oral specialist can assess the circumstance and supply appropriate treatment to recover security.
Clicking or Popping Jaw Joint
Do you experience a hitting or standing out sensation in your jaw joint? This could be a sign that you need to get in touch with a dental cosmetic surgeon promptly.
Clicking or appearing the jaw joint, additionally referred to as the temporomandibular joint (TMJ), can show a trouble with the joint's positioning or feature. It might be caused by conditions such as TMJ disorder, joint inflammation, or a displaced disc in the joint.
This clicking or standing out can lead to discomfort, pain, and problem in opening up or shutting your mouth. If left without treatment, it can aggravate and affect your every day life.
Consequently, it is essential to look for the knowledge of a dental doctor who can detect the underlying reason and offer proper therapy alternatives to ease your symptoms and protect against more difficulties.
